Market Overview
The Robotic Surgical Simulation Systems Market is revolutionizing how surgeons are trained, offering a safe, immersive, and highly effective environment to develop and refine their skills. These advanced systems leverage virtual reality (VR), augmented reality (AR), and haptic feedback to replicate real surgical procedures, allowing practitioners to practice complex techniques without risk to patients. The market is driven by the increasing adoption of robotic surgery, a growing emphasis on patient safety, and the need for efficient, scalable surgical training.
Current Market Landscape
According to WiseGuy Reports, the Robotic Surgical Simulation Systems Market was valued at USD 2.48 Billion in 2024 and is projected to reach USD 7.5 Billion by 2035, growing at a CAGR of 10.6%. North America leads the market, driven by a strong healthcare infrastructure and high investment in robotic technologies. Hospitals are a primary end-user. Key players include Intuitive Surgical, Medtronic, and Simbionix.
Emerging Trends
Technological advancements, such as improved haptic feedback and VR integration, are enhancing training efficacy. There is a growing focus on developing AI-powered simulators that adapt to the user's skill level. The expansion of simulation into new surgical specialties and the rise of tele-surgery training are key trends. The demand for minimally invasive procedures is a major driver.
